Today Bandha Ghorar Dim or Toray Bandha Ghorar Dim (Script error: The function "langx" does not exist.) is a collection of nonsense rhymes by the Indian film director Satyajit Ray in Bengali.[1] The collection contains several translated rhymes and limericks besides some original works by him. The book included a translation of Lewis Carroll's Jabberwocky. Translations from Edward Lear and Hilaire Belloc were also there in the collection.
